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Berkley Place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Berkley Place with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Berkley Place is at Lake Castleton listed at $1,194.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Berkley Place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Berkley Place is $1,560.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Berkley Place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Berkley Place is a 1,361 square feet unit starting from $1,835 at Lake Clearwater Apartments.

What is the average size for Berkley Place 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Berkley Place is currently 1,051 sq ft.
